Crushing the Head of a Snake

Described in popular crime dramas on television as "blunt-force trauma," bashing in the head of a snake is effective at ending its life. I've probably said this numerous times in the article already, but please don't kill snakes. While they are scary looking and their ability to sneak up on you makes for the stuff of nightmares, they are only going to attack when threatened. Nearly all snake bites are the result of humans instigating aggression towards a snake who is just minding his or her own business.
